Crafted as a homage to pastoral mountain life, this original low stool, affectionately known as the Berger Stool, encapsulates Perriand’s mastery of form and material. Inspired by the rugged beauty of the Alps, this stool seamlessly integrates typical materials of the region into its design. Exemplifying Perriand’s dedication to craftsmanship, this piece is a testament to traditional woodworking techniques. Delicate tapered legs and meticulous joinery details showcase the skillful artistry behind its creation. Beneath the seat lies the hallmark connection, a nod to the artisanal process of turning wood. The honest aging and patina of the wood only enhance the authenticity and character of this piece. Acquired from a prestigious European collection, this stool comes with a rich provenance, further accentuating its significance. Included in the esteemed literature “Charlotte Perriand Complete Works Volume 2: 1940-1955,” this stool represents a chapter in the illustrious career of a design luminary.
